Speechius is a desktop teleprompter that scrolls when you speak. Speech recognition runs entirely on device and matches what you actually said against your script, so the text moves at your pace instead of a fixed speed. Pause and it waits. Go off-script and it catches up on its own.
It is not a dictation tool: nothing is transcribed into a document. Your script stays your script, and the app only decides how far you have got.

People who record screencasts and tutorials, run webinars and online classes, or rehearse conference talks, and who want to sound spoken rather than read.
Practical details
macOS 13 or newer and Windows 10/11. Recognition in English and German. One-time purchase, no subscription, with a 14-day trial that starts with your first recognition session.

It recognises the words you actually say and finds them in your script, rather than scrolling on a timer or reacting to how loudly and quickly you speak. That means it still follows you when you rephrase a sentence, skip a line or jump back.
Recognition runs entirely on your own device, and the window can be excluded from screen sharing and screen recording.

Several teleprompters advertise voice-controlled scrolling, but most of them track your speaking pace and volume: they speed up when you speak faster and stop when you go quiet. They do not know which words you said, so going off-script or jumping back confuses them.
Speechius matches the recognised words against your script, which is the part that keeps working when you stop reading and start talking. It is also a one-time purchase rather than a subscription, and nothing is sent to a server.

I record programming tutorials for my own YouTube channel, and neither option worked for me: reading from a script sounds read, and improvising means losing the thread until a ten-minute recording takes forty. Existing teleprompters scroll at a fixed pace, so I ended up chasing the text instead of explaining.
I built the thing I wanted, and it turned into my first own product, released in July 2026.
